Platja Palmira

4.5
(3508)
•
4.2
(179)
Outdoor Activities
Beaches
Platja Palmira is a stunning, elongated sandy beach boasting numerous eateries and watering holes along its promenade. The area also includes the availability of sun loungers and showers, although it is advisable to keep belongings safe due to the risk of theft. Multiple lifeguards monitor the beach's central section, with public restrooms conveniently located nearby for a nominal fee. A free toilet facility can be found at an ice cream stand situated toward the right-hand end of the beach.

Casa Enrique

4.6
(1432)
•
4.3
(312)
$$$$cheap
Restaurant
Spanish restaurant
Tapas restaurant
Casa Enrique is a lively spot known for its vibrant tapas, grilled steak, and sangria. It offers extensive outdoor seating and attracts a bustling crowd. The menu features authentic, non-pretentious Spanish tapas that are enjoyed by locals on a daily basis. The prices are affordable, especially when compared to other establishments in Paguera. The staff is friendly and accommodating, although the ventilation could be improved as it tends to get hot inside.

MAR Y MAR

4.5
(2754)
•
4.4
(1034)
$$$$affordable
Restaurant
Mediterranean restaurant
Seafood restaurant
Spanish restaurant
Nestled in the charming locale of Peguera, MAR Y MAR is a delightful fusion restaurant that promises an unforgettable dining experience. With five distinct areas to choose from, including a beach bar and cozy indoor lounge, it caters to every mood and occasion. The menu features seasonal international fare crafted from locally sourced ingredients, ensuring freshness in every bite. Whether you're sipping on expertly mixed cocktails or indulging in diverse culinary delights, MAR Y MAR offers a vibrant atmosphere perfect for both casual gatherings and special celebrations.

La Vida Peguera Restaurant & Beach Lounge

4.3
(750)
•
4.2
(366)
$$$$affordable
Restaurant
La Vida Peguera Restaurant & Beach Lounge is a charming beachside eatery with a stunning outdoor seating area adorned with large red sails for shade. The menu features a delightful fusion of Spanish and German cuisine, offering cold cuts, mixed breads for breakfast, tapas for dinner, and refreshing drinks like Aperol Spritz at the beach lounge. The staff is known for their exceptional hospitality even during busy times.

Restaurante Gaby

4.3
(1097)
•
4.5
(263)
Permanently Closed
$$$$affordable
Mediterranean restaurant
Restaurante Gaby is a popular dining spot in Mallorca that keeps visitors coming back for more. The restaurant offers generous portions and delicious food, making it a must-visit while on the island. Guests have praised the friendly and helpful staff, reasonable prices, and tasty dishes such as stir fry prawns masala, chicken escalopes with mozzarella, grilled dorada, garlic chicken, liver & bacon. The seafood dishes are particularly recommended for their large portions and reasonable prices.

Restaurante La Gritta

4.5
(1084)
•
4.3
(502)
$$$$expensive
Mediterranean restaurant
Restaurante La Gritta is an upscale eatery offering refined European cuisine and an extensive selection of wines. Situated on a sophisticated terrace overlooking the sea, this restaurant provides a picturesque setting to enjoy delicious food. With its elegant ambiance and breathtaking views, it is an ideal venue for special occasions or simply indulging in a memorable dining experience. The service here is attentive and friendly, adding to the overall charm of the place.
